Even when spot bitcoin ETFs arrived, many clients were still stuck in the same awkward loop, curiosity on one side, permission on the other.<\/p>\n<p>Bank of America\u2019s change breaks that loop. Starting January 5, 2026, advisers move from simply executing a trade to being able to recommend regulated crypto products as part of a portfolio, which matters because advice is where habits form. When something gets framed as \u201ca small sleeve\u201d rather than \u201ca punt,\u201d it stops being a late-night decision and starts becoming a line item.<\/p>\n<p>### What clients are actually being offered<\/p>\n<p>In practice, this first step looks very Bitcoin-heavy.<\/p>\n<p>Industry reporting says the initial shelf includes four bitcoin ETPs, including the Bitwise Bitcoin ETF, Grayscale\u2019s Bitcoin Mini Trust, Fidelity\u2019s Wise Origin Bitcoin Fund, and BlackRock\u2019s iShares Bitcoin Trust.<\/p>\n<p>There\u2019s also an important operational detail here, advisers reportedly need training to participate, plus an implementation and allocation guidance paper from the chief investment office. That\u2019s boring, and it\u2019s the point.<\/p>\n<p>Bitcoin doesn\u2019t need another hype cycle. It needs distribution that can survive a bad month.<\/p>\n<p>### Why 1% to 4% can still be a big deal<\/p>\n<p>Four percent sounds tiny until you remember how wealth actually moves.<\/p>\n<p>Large advisory platforms rarely flip a switch and send billions into a new asset overnight. What they do is allow a product, build a process, teach the advisers how to talk about it, and let adoption crawl forward, client by client, review meeting by review meeting.<\/p>\n<p>That slow-motion adoption is exactly what makes this different from the typical crypto headline.<\/p>\n<p>Bank of America\u2019s wealth unit is massive, Reuters reported the bank\u2019s core wealth management business, including Merrill and its private bank, manages about $4.6 trillion in client assets.<\/p>\n<p>Here\u2019s a simple way to think about it.<\/p>\n<p>If only 5% of those assets eventually adopt a 2% Bitcoin sleeve, that\u2019s around $4.6T x 5% x 2%, roughly $4.6 billion. If adoption reached 10% at a 4% sleeve, you get $18.4 billion. These are scenario ranges, not forecasts, and the main point is the same, small portfolio weights on huge platforms add up quickly.<\/p>\n<p>Even the low case matters because bitcoin ETF flows tend to arrive in bursts, and the marginal buyer often sets the price in crypto markets.<\/p>\n<div class=\"code-block code-block-5\" style=\"margin: 8px 0; clear: both;\">\n<div class=\"placement desktop us-deny-hide hidden\" style=\"max-height: 107px\">  <img fetchpriority=\"high\" width=\"1456\" height=\"180\" decoding=\"async\" style=\"display: block; width: 728px; max-height: 90px; max-width: 100%; margin: auto; height: 90px;\" src=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/bc_game168_Sposorship_1456x180.gif\" alt=\"BC Game\"\/><img class=\"lazyload\" width=\"1456\" height=\"180\" decoding=\"async\" style=\"display: block; width: 728px; max-height: 90px; max-width: 100%; margin: auto; height: 90px;\" src=\"https:\/\/cryptoslate.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/11\/bc_game168_Sposorship_1456x180.gif\" alt=\"BC Game\"\/> <\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p>### The timing, Bitcoin is bruised, still mainstream, and still volatile<\/p>\n<p>This shift lands after a year that reminded everyone what Bitcoin really is.<\/p>\n<p>Reuters reported bitcoin hit an all-time high above $126,000 in October 2025, then got hammered as macro shocks hit risk appetite, with analysts noting bitcoin\u2019s growing tendency to trade like a risk asset.<\/p>\n<p>Bank of America itself pointed to the downside, Reuters noted bitcoin lost more than $18,000 in November 2025, its biggest monthly dollar drop since May 2021.<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s the backdrop, volatility is not fading away, it is being formalised.<\/p>\n<p>As of today, bitcoin is trading around $92,000, according to CoinMarketCap, which also shows that October high and the distance from it. For long-time holders, this is familiar. For wealth clients who prefer smooth lines, it\u2019s a warning label.<\/p>\n<p>### The macro layer, why this could matter even more in 2026<\/p>\n<p>A lot of the next move for bitcoin is going to be decided outside crypto.<\/p>\n<p>The Federal Reserve is currently targeting a fed funds range of 3.50% to 3.75%. Inflation, meanwhile, was running at 2.7% year over year through November.<\/p>\n<p>Those numbers matter because crypto still lives on liquidity and sentiment. Easier money tends to help speculative assets breathe. Sticky inflation and rate uncertainty tend to do the opposite. Bitcoin has matured enough to show up in mainstream portfolios, it hasn\u2019t matured enough to ignore the macro weather.<\/p>\n<p>This is why Bank of America\u2019s framing is so telling. Advisers are being told to treat digital assets like a satellite sleeve for clients who can handle volatility, Reuters quoted the bank warning that speculative activity can push prices beyond \u201ctrue utility.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s a traditional finance way of saying the quiet part again, bitcoin can be valuable, the ride can still be brutal.<\/p>\n<p>### What this unlocks for Bitcoin, and what it does not<\/p>\n<p>This does not instantly turn Bank of America into a crypto bank. It doesn\u2019t guarantee a flood of inflows. It doesn\u2019t erase the scars of 2022, or the hangover of late 2025.<\/p>\n<p>What it does is more durable.<\/p>\n<p>It puts bitcoin ETFs in the path of the most ordinary money in America, retirement rollovers, college funds, business owners who sold a company, families who do one portfolio review a year and then go back to living their lives.<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s the kind of demand bitcoin has always chased, because it\u2019s less emotional, more process-driven, and it tends to stick around longer.<\/p>\n<p>The irony is that the allocation being discussed is small. The cultural shift is the big thing. Bitcoin keeps getting absorbed into the system it was built to route around, and every time that happens, the price story becomes less about a single catalyst and more about a slow grind of legitimacy, distribution, and macro conditions.<\/p>\n<p>January 5 is a calendar date.
